Output 753e43c6016e3d4b44b4d3e3d9a34e4a7f36a86390017bcc17104f1ca2193863:6

value
1248628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902ef94d42a0407547692462ae767b91e80cc51a OP_EQUAL
address
3EqPVy1xYCWYGAKkZQAHN83DfzesuJojqR
transaction
753e43c6016e3d4b44b4d3e3d9a34e4a7f36a86390017bcc17104f1ca2193863
spent
true